Properties of the scaled factorial moments are analytically studied within the framework of the Landau mean field approach. Dependences of the moments on resolution are found to be different for first-order and second-order phase transitions. It is suggested that the moments ln Fq should be fitted to powers of X≡ δ1/3 in the range of high resolution in order to extract information about the phase transition in a parameter independent way.
